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
53077004993 345 2289359 3078 7156927
9510 69490516294 8341912720
9510 69490516294 8341912720
8962 30986117 96706570150
All about undefined
Interested in learning more?
9510 69490516294 8341912720
8962 30986117 96706570150
See more
39358546114 217 56
50632 8403927 0991880
See more
0252165 8372 8652
27763377672 4586 67313 67653207470
See more